dmytro_ushatenko/pages/students/2022/daniil_huzenko/README.md

3.0 KiB
Raw Blame History

title published taxonomy
Daniil Huzenko true
category tag author
bp2025
klaud
Daniel Hladek

rok začiatku štúdia: 2022

Bakalárska práca 2025

Vedúci: doc. Matúš Pleva PhD.

Predbežný názov:

Testovanie hybridného klaudu s využiťím kombinácie verejného a privátneho riešenia

Cielom práce je vytvorenie vzelávacích materiálov o Kubernetes a funkčného prototypu privátneho klastra Kubernetes .

Stetnutie 22.11.2024

Stav:

  • Klaster funguje. Ku každému node je možné sa pripojiť cez SSH.
  • Momentálne notebook slúži ako router.
  • Práca na DNS MASQ prideľovanie IP adries z routra.

Úlohy:

  • Napíšte návod a skripty pre konfiguráciu routra pre K8s klastra SuperC.
  • Router by mal vedieť:
    • prideliť IP adresu v privátnej podsieti pre všetky uzly klastra.
    • slúžiť ako rozhranie medzi verejnou a súkronou sieťou - mal by sprostredkovať služby Kubernetes.
    • mal by vedieť konfigurovať klaster pomocou Ansible.
  • Vyporacujte video a textový tutoriál k inštalácii klastra.

Stretnutie 14.11

Stav:

  • 1 ks klastra je zmontovany

Úlohy:

  • Napíšte o tom čo je to kontajnerizácia, čo je Kubernetes, stručne o Rpi CM4 a Super6C - opíšte HW.
  • Píšte o metódach orchestrácie. Čo je to a akými metódami sa to robí?
  • Napíšte o Ansible. Ako riadiť klaster pomocou Ansible?
  • Citujte knihy a odborné články. Nájdete to na google scholar.

Zásobník úloh:

  • Pripravte skripty Ansible pre "setup" klastra
  • Pripravte skripty pre "reinstall" klastra poocou Ansible
  • Zistite ako funguje netboot na rpi, skúste reinstall cez networkboot.

Stretnutie 12.11.2024

Stav:

  • Písanie draftu BP
  • Vyskúšané tutoriály s Minikube.

Úlohy:

  • Zmontujte Raspberry Pi klaster: 1x skrinka s príslušenstvom, 6x RPI Compute Module 4, 1 doska a zdroj SUper6C.
  • Urobte videoblog o tom ako zmontovať RPI klaster. Akým jazykom? Po rusky alebo po slovensky?
  • Zistite čo je to MicroK8s
  • Pokračujte v písaní BP. Používajte citácie na odbornú literatúru ()knihy a odborné články. Do BP píšte aj o hardvéri ktorý ste dostali. Odborné články nájdete na google scholar.
  • Prihláste sa na Azure KLaud.

Zásobník úloh:

  • Oživte klaster a nainštalujte na neho MicroK8s. Inštaláciu urobte ľahko opakovateľnú pomocou skriptu.
  • Nainštalujte monitorovacie nástroje na klaster.
  • Urobte deployment aplikácie na privány klaster aj na verejnmý klaster (AKS).
  • Urobte druhý videoblog o inštalácii softvéru na náš klaster.
  • Napíšte textový blog o tom čo ste urobili - cieľ je poučiť a inšpirovať študentov.

Stretnutie 4.10.2024

Stav:

Naštudovaný Kubernetes, nainštalované Minikube

Úlohy:

  • Napíšte draft BP. Napíšte čo je to Kubernetes a ako sa používa.čo je to kontajnerizácia
  • Napíšte, aké nástroje sa používajú na monitoring klastra.
  • [-] Vyskúšajte a opíšte nástroj Prometheus, Istio. Zistite čo je service-mesh. Čo je „network fabric“ Calico.